Portraits of Russia: Aslanbek, plumber
Photo: Atsamaz Dzivaev/PublicPost I wanted to become a doctor, I was afraid of my mother, I married a general’s daughter, I was imprisoned for stealing timber, I gave birth to three daughters, I lost everything, I believe that happiness is when an understanding person is next to you. About childhood I was born a frail child. They nursed me for a long time, the aunties said. My parents worked at a fish factory in Makhachkala, and we lived not far from the city.
